Re: Perlcode: Was ist falsch? - baseportal Forum - Web-Anwendungen einfach, schnell, leistungsfähig!
baseportal
English - Deutsch "Es gibt keine dummen Fragen - jeder hat einmal angefangen"

 baseportal-ForumDie aktuellsten 10, 30, 50, 100 Einträge anzeigen.  

 
 Ausgewählter Eintrag: Zur Liste 
    Beitrag von Tiger (42 Beiträge) am Samstag, 11.August.2001, 11:29.
    Re: Perlcode: Was ist falsch?

      danke an alle, aber irgendwie geht das noch immer nicht... :(
      http://baseportal.de/cgi-bin/baseportal.pl?htx=/Tiger/fun/witze#2
      hülfe! :)
      gruß
      chris

      <loop db=/Tiger/fun/witze sort=- Art~=Blond>
      <p>
      $Text<br>
      <small>
      gepostet am $Datum
      <perl>
      if ($Autor ne "")
      {
      out "by $Autor";
      }
      if ($eMail ne "")
      {
      out ", <a href=\"mailto:$eMail?subject=Witz\">$eMail</a>.";
      }
      </perl>
      </small>
      </p>
      </loop>
      


    Ihre Antwort:

    Name: EMail: EMail bei Antwort? WWW:
    Titel:
    Text:

    Neuer Eintrag


 Alle Einträge zum Thema: Zur Liste 
    Beitrag von Tiger (42 Beiträge) am Donnerstag, 9.August.2001, 15:41.
    Perlcode: Was ist falsch?

      Hallo!
      Was ist daran falsch?
      <loop db=/Tiger/fun/witze sort=- Art~=Blond>
      <p>
      $Text<br>
      <small>
      gepostet am $Datum
      <perl>
      if (Autor ne "")
      {
      out "by $Autor";
      }
      if (eMail ne "")
      {
      out ", <a href=\"mailto:$eMail?subject=Witz\">$eMail</a>.";
      }
      </perl>
      </small>
      </p>
      </loop>
      
      danke!

     Antworten

    Beitrag von daniel (83 Beiträge) am Donnerstag, 9.August.2001, 16:52.
    Re: Perlcode: Was ist falsch?

      hi

      ich arbeite nich mt loop aber direkt in perl müsste es heissen


      out ", <a href=\"mailto:",$eMail,"?subject=Witz\">",$eMail,"</a>.";
      

      also die $eMail außerhalb des Strings

     Antworten

    Beitrag von Sander (8133 Beiträge) am Donnerstag, 9.August.2001, 18:08.
    Re: Perlcode: Was ist falsch?

      das brauchts eben in perl nicht. Hier kannst du die Vars mit in den Ausgabetext schreiben. Wenn es extra stehen muß (wie bei convert_url), gehört in Perl ein . hin zum zusammenfügen.

      out "blabla".convert_url($blub)."blablabla";
      

      Sander

     Antworten

    Beitrag von anonym (129 Beiträge) am Donnerstag, 9.August.2001, 17:33.
    Re: Perlcode: Was ist falsch?

      Falsche Variablenbezeichnungen

      if ($Autor
      

      if ($eMail

     Antworten

    Beitrag von Tiger (42 Beiträge) am Samstag, 11.August.2001, 11:29.
    Re: Perlcode: Was ist falsch?

      danke an alle, aber irgendwie geht das noch immer nicht... :(
      http://baseportal.de/cgi-bin/baseportal.pl?htx=/Tiger/fun/witze#2
      hülfe! :)
      gruß
      chris

      <loop db=/Tiger/fun/witze sort=- Art~=Blond>
      <p>
      $Text<br>
      <small>
      gepostet am $Datum
      <perl>
      if ($Autor ne "")
      {
      out "by $Autor";
      }
      if ($eMail ne "")
      {
      out ", <a href=\"mailto:$eMail?subject=Witz\">$eMail</a>.";
      }
      </perl>
      </small>
      </p>
      </loop>
      

     Antworten

    Beitrag von Claus S. (1671 Beiträge) am Samstag, 11.August.2001, 12:48.
    Re: Perlcode: Was ist falsch?

      hallo tiger,

      merkwürdig, sieht eigentlich alles richtig aus...
      vielleicht stört sich das loop an perl,
      mach mal die perl tags raus und schreibe
      <loop db=..... code=perl> bla bla </loop>
      
      vielleicht hilfts.

      gruss claus

     Antworten

    Beitrag von Sander (8133 Beiträge) am Samstag, 11.August.2001, 14:18.
    Re: Perlcode: Was ist falsch?

      genau, Claus hat recht, <perl> in loop geht nicht
      aber so wie er es beschrieben hat im loop Aufruf. Danach muß nur bei der Ausgabe mit Perlmitteln gearbeitet werden.

      Sander

     Antworten

    Beitrag von Tiger (42 Beiträge) am Samstag, 11.August.2001, 17:56.
    Re: Perlcode: Was ist falsch?

      tja, baseportal kann mich wohl nicht leiden... ;)
      es geht immer noch nicht... :(
      weitere vorschläge?
      gruß & danke
      christian
      http://baseportal.de/cgi-bin/baseportal.pl?htx=/Tiger/fun/witze#2


      <loop db=/Tiger/fun/witze sort=- Art~=Andere code=Perl>
      <p>
      $Text<br>
      <small>
      gepostet am $Datum
      

      if ($Autor ne "")
      {
      out "by $Autor";
      }
      if ($eMail ne "")
      {
      out ", <a href=\"mailto:$eMail?subject=Witz\">$eMail</a>.";
      }
      

      </small>
      </p>
      </loop>
      

     Antworten

    Beitrag von Sander (8133 Beiträge) am Samstag, 11.August.2001, 18:02.
    Re: Perlcode: Was ist falsch?

      das meine ich mit perlmitteln ;-)
      <loop db=/Tiger/fun/witze sort=- Art~=Andere code=Perl>
      

      out <<EOF;
      <p>
      $Text<br>
      <small>
       gepostet am $Datum
      EOF
      

      if ($Autor ne "")
      {
      out "by $Autor";
      }
      if ($eMail ne "")
      {
      out ", <a href=\"mailto:$eMail?subject=Witz\">$eMail</a>.";
      }
      

      out <<EOF;
      </small>
      </p>
      EOF
      

      </loop>
       
      Sander

     Antworten

    Beitrag von Tiger (42 Beiträge) am Sonntag, 12.August.2001, 18:20.
    Re: Perlcode: Was ist falsch?

      danke, es läuft! *freu* :)

     Antworten


     
 Liste der Einträge von 58351 bis 58501:Einklappen Zur Eingabe 
Neueste Einträge << 10 | 9 | 8 | 7 | 6 | 5 | 4 | 3 | 2 | Neuere Einträge < Zur Eingabe  > Ältere Einträge |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 >> Älteste Einträge


Zurück zur Homepage

© baseportal.de. Alle Rechte vorbehalten. Nutzungsbedingungen



powered in 0.08s by baseportal.de
Erstellen Sie Ihre eigene Web-Datenbank - kostenlos!